




I recently put the 150W Variable Speed Electric Disc Sanding Machine to the test on several small woodcraft projects. This compact tool brings professional-level control to a hobbyist workbench without taking up excessive space.
The unit features a sturdy 150W motor that handles 4, 5, and 6-inch discs with impressive stability. While compact, the chassis feels durable enough to withstand regular grinding tasks in a home garage setting.
Using the variable speed dial, which goes up to 6000 RPM, makes switching between aggressive stock removal and fine finishing incredibly smooth. The setup is straightforward, and having ten included sanding discs meant I could start my first project immediately out of the box.
